About BRP Inc.

BRP Inc. is a Canadian company that designs, develops, manufactures, distributes, and markets powersports vehicles and propulsion systems. The company's products include Ski-Doo and Lynx snowmobiles, Sea-Doo watercraft, Can-Am on- and off-road vehicles, Alumacraft and Manitou boats, Evinrude and Rotax marine propulsion systems, and Rotax engines for karts, motorcycles, and recreational aircraft. BRP was founded in 1942 and is headquartered in Valcourt, Quebec.
